AR022B Vitaleda

Physical geography
An overview of climate, topography and landscape of the country. With the exception of Beginner territories, you should always create a sketch map to illustrate & explain your plans. You can add a link to this (hosted on imgBB, Postimages or similar, but not imgur.com)


Vitaleda is located in a tropical zone, with coastlines to the north and east, and a diverse geography that combines mountains, valleys, and coastlines.

Climate:

-Tropical humid: Most of the country has a tropical humid climate, with average temperatures ranging from 22°C to 28°C.

-Seasons: There are two main seasons: a dry season (December to April) and a rainy season (May to November).

Topography:

- Fatima Mountain Range: The Fatima mountain range runs through the country from center to south, creating a mountainous landscape with peaks that exceed 2,000 meters in height.

- Valleys: The valleys of Brumaria are fertile and inhabited by most of the population.

- Coastline: Vitaleda's coastline is rocky and mountainous, with some white sand beaches and crystal-clear waters.

Landscape:

- Mountains: Vitaleda's mountains are covered in tropical and subtropical forests, with a wide variety of flora and fauna.

- Rivers: Rivers are numerous and flowing, and are used for hydroelectric power generation and crop irrigation.

- Waterfalls: There are several impressive waterfalls in the country, popular among tourists.
